What to expect
You'll depart early from Kotor's marina, skimming past the abandoned Austro-Hungarian submarine base carved into the cliffside at Zanjic. Reaching the Blue Cave before the crowds, you'll swim inside where sunlight refracts through the water into an intense electric blue. Your skipper then takes you past Mamula Island's fortress and a quiet cove for a second swim stop before returning.
Good to know
Swimsuits and towels essential; best light in the cave is 9-11am, so request an early departure; water can be cool even in summer
